The summer transfer window for Manchester United seems to be getting worse and worse.



Frenkie De Jong, a Barcelona midfielder who is Erik ten Hag's top target, is expected to leave the Red Devils, but even finding replacements is proving challenging.

According to a recent article from la Gazzetta dello Sport (via Juventus News 24), Adrien Rabiot, a midfielder for Juventus who had been identified as a target, is "reluctant" to sign with the Red Devils.

It has been noted that the 27-year-old France international, who has one year left on his contract with Turin, wants to participate in the Champions League this year, and ten Hag is unable to provide him with that opportunity.

The fact that United was compelled to compete in Europe's second tier this season as a result of their failure to earn a spot in the prestigious Champions League appears to be having a significant impact.

With less than three weeks left in the transfer window, ten Hag would be pulling his hair out if he had any if neither Rabiot nor De Jong were signed. This would leave the Dutchman desperately short of midfield reinforcements.
